
Washington Advance Directive Form
An advance directive in Washington is a legal document that enables an individual to outline their healthcare preferences regarding end-of-life care and appoint an agent to ensure these wishes are fulfilled. This form provides the individual the opportunity to specify their desires concerning life-sustaining treatments, including options for artificial respiration and feeding assistance, allowing for a clear expression of their healthcare choices.
Signing Requirements
Two witnesses or a notary public.
